Biography
Johan Bernhard Siqueland Knudsen, senior specialist for water planning and
climate adaptation, COWI A/S, specializes in water resources and environmental
assessments and planning, hydrogeology and water rock quality evaluations,
economic and institutional studies for strengthening the management and
financing of water and energy services, and monitoring and evaluating donor
programs and projects. His 20 years of professional experience have evolved
from the design and construction of groundwater supply and feasibility studies
for hydropower dams and transmission lines to economic and institutional studies
aimed at policy development for management of water and energy resources.
Since 2011, he has supported the petroleum industry in Sudan and South Sudan by assessing pollution risk and devising mitigation measures and by working on
changes to regulations and capacity building for regulatory agencies to monitor
and enforce an improved regime in health, safety, and the environment. Siqueland
Knudsen has an MSc in groundwater engineering from the University of
Newcastle Upon Tyne, United Kindgom; a master’s degree in economics from
the Norwegian School of Commerce; and a PhD in hydrogeology from the
University of Oslo, Norway.
